最佳的库或方法来异步地从无线连接的Arduino绘制数据。

本质上,我有一个Arduino,上面装有超过10个传感器,将在飞行中收集和记录时间戳数据。它还将无线序列化并将此数据发送到地面上的笔记本电脑。

笔记本电脑需要具有能够读取无线串行数据,解析其内容,确定数据来自哪个传感器,并在图表上绘制数据(根据数据是线条或柱状图)。读取和反序列化部分不应该成为问题。我正在寻找的是创建二维图表的最佳/最简单的库或方法,以便在数据到达时,将图表移动(如有必要),并根据伴随的时间戳绘制图表点。

此软件基本上将作为项目的仪表板或控制面板运行。需要向该窗口添加许多图形来处理当前存在的每个传感器以及可能存在的传感器。

基于此主题,我能找到的最接近的内容如下。

是否有任何数据可视化、绘图、绘制或图形库,最适合解决这样的项目?

任何编程语言都可以。

原文链接 https://stackoverflow.com/questions/8222446

点赞
stackoverflow用户513763
stackoverflow用户513763

也许使用 gnuplot 是一个选项,就像他们在 这里 做的那样。

2011-11-22 12:55:53
stackoverflow用户639045
stackoverflow用户639045

欢迎尝试 Processing

同时你也可以看看这些书: http://processing.org/learning/books/

2011-11-22 14:32:19